EUVIMED is the European alternative to PubMed: a central, multilingual research platform for medicine, nursing, life sciences and healthcare. It brings together international and European literature sources, study registries, open-access full texts, citations and retraction notices in one search. Unlike pure bibliographic databases, EUVIMED supports the entire research process – from discovery and appraisal with LIVIA and CLARA to traceable evidence synthesis. <h4>Background</h4>To ensure the adequate nurse staffing levels and retain intensive care unit (ICU) nurses, it is important to understand the impact of nurse staffing policies on nurse outcomes during the COVID-19 pandemic.<h4>Aim</h4>This study examined the impact of nurse staffing policies in ICUs on nurse outcomes before and during the COVID-19 pandemic.<h4>Study design</h4>We conducted a secondary data analysis of a nationally representative sample of nurses working in ICUs. Data from the 2018 (before COVID-19) and 2022 (during COVID-19) National Sample Surveys of Registered Nurses (NSSRN) in the United States were used. The association between nurse staffing policies and nurse outcomes (job satisfaction, turnover and turnover due to burnout and inadequate staffing) in ICUs was examined using logistic regression analysis. A difference-in-differences analysis using the 2018 and 2022 NSSRN datasets was used to examine the longitudinal effects of the policy.<h4>Results</h4>In the state fixed effects model, the nurse staffing policy in ICUs was not significantly associated with the likelihood of job satisfaction. Meanwhile, nurse staffing policy was negatively and significantly associated with nurse turnover. Thus, the presence of a nurse staffing policy may decrease the likelihood of turnover during the COVID-19 pandemic compared to the absence of a nurse staffing policy (β = -0.12, p = 0.013).<h4>Conclusions</h4>The nurse staffing policy in ICUs effectively reduced turnover during the COVID-19 pandemic. However, it was not significantly associated with job satisfaction, turnover due to burnout and turnover due to inadequate staffing.<h4>Relevance to clinical practice</h4>During the COVID-19 pandemic, nurse staffing policies could improve nurse retention in ICUs. To enhance nurses' job satisfaction and reduce burnout, further staffing policy development is necessary to improve the appropriate staffing levels among nurses.
